Just received a phone call from my gyny with blood test results. I am def not preggies but results show high prolactin levels. Prolactin is a hormone produced by the pituitary gland, which lies under the brain in the skull. Increased levels of prolactin will occur for several reasons. They occur naturally in pregnancy and lactation but will also be raised during STRESS. My body experienced STRESS coz of surgery.
